Challenge:

A marine geophysical survey contractor was expanding from single-channel to multi-channel seismic acquisition to meet growing demand for offshore wind and near-surface studies. They needed a processing system that was robust at sea, easy to deploy on vessels with limited connectivity, and flexible enough to run the same workflows in the office.

Solution:

By adopting Claritas, the company implemented a shared license model that let teams seamlessly switch software access between the office and offshore vessels—maximising utilisation while minimising cost. Claritas’s UHR (Ultra-High-Resolution) seismic modules provided the precise imaging tools needed for shallow marine interpretation. In addition, customised Claritas training ensured field and office teams quickly gained proficiency in multi-channel seismic processing.

Result:

The contractor now delivers higher-quality data faster, using consistent workflows from vessel to final report. The ability to process UHR seismic data in-house has opened new revenue opportunities and improved control over project schedules and deliverables.
